Output 426bffe98824119f705039e48d150a66c8c9251cba0dbf99a9ae03d864ba1996:1

value
17240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e58883841dbf37d2f2689c71f31fcb87eefe47 OP_EQUAL
address
MJjpwKJnqbka9PSXGz9Hy4gLPY3UXYgetj
transaction
426bffe98824119f705039e48d150a66c8c9251cba0dbf99a9ae03d864ba1996
spent
true